Notes

Australian WRC 2nd pressing for their "Young World" division. Mono and stereo versions have an identical sleeve and the same number on the back (YC 1517) - the mono version has "YC-1517" on pink 'Young World' labels, while the stereo has "SYC-1517". Orchestra and chorus uncredited. There is a printed "stereo" rosette on the back, and the mono has a red sticker with "mono" placed over this (though these tend to drop off with age). The addresses on the rear of the sleeve have been updated. Issued again in June 1966 (probably with "299" for the Flinders Lane address, instead of the previous 330 or the short-lived 393).

Wild Is Love is a 1960 concept album by the American singer and pianist Nat King Cole, arranged by Nelson Riddle. The album chronicles a narrator's attempts to pick up various women before he finds love at the conclusion of the album. The album formed the basis for an unsuccessful musical, I'm With You, that starred Cole and was intended as a potential Broadway vehicle for him. Wild Is Love, is Nat King Cole's twenty-second studio album, released in 1960. This is one of the several albums that were arranged by Nelson Riddle. In addition to the Nelson Riddle arrangements, all of the songs featured in Wild Is Love were written by Ray Rasch and Dotty Wayne. The album was structured very similarly to that of Concept albums from artists such as Frank Sinatra, featuring an introduction and ending to the story of the album, as well as having the tracks of the album tell a slight story. In his extended sleeve note, Nat King Cole writes of his desire as an artist to find something else, by which he seems to mean something other than yet another album of rearranged pop standards, and he claims to have found it in the work of songwriters Ray Rasch and Dotty Wayne, who fashioned the song cycle contained on this LP.
